  • 自動回轉刀架CNC lathe work order to be able to complete a fixture in many processes processing aids to reduce time, reduce installation time and again caused by processing errors, we must turn with automatic tool. Installed in accordance with the number of different knives, automatic revolving turret at position four of six and eight-station work spaces and other forms. According to the different installation methods, automatic rotary tool can be divided into two types of vertical and horizontal. Positioning means according to the different mechanical, automatic rotary tool set can be divided into client positioning tooth and three teeth, such as disk-based positioning. The interruption of tooth plate-type tool change position to be lifted when the tool carrier, tool change a slow and poor sealing, but its relatively simple structure. Tridentate known disk-based location-free lift-type, characterized by ATC when the tool is not lifted, so when the tool change is fast and good seal, but its more complicate
    structure.
    Automatic rotary tool in the structure must have good strength and rigidity to bear the rough at the time of cutting resistance. In order to ensure a high transposition of the repeat positioning accuracy, automatic rotary tool holder of the position would also like to choose a reliable and reasonable positioning program structure. Rotary Tool Automatic Tool Changer automatically by the control system and the drive circuit to achieve.
